## Goods Lift — Deliveries Only

The goods lift at Merrowgate House serves the loading bay and floors two through six. It is reserved for couriers, pallets, and catering trolleys; do not use it for regular passenger travel. Team assistants booking a large delivery should reserve a slot with the facilities desk a day ahead. The lift call panel at the loading bay is keypad-operated; to call the lift, enter the code below.

door code, kawip-bagap: bdg-HQEWH-4

MEMO — Finance Team. The Dunphy Street satellite office closes end of next month. Stop new purchase orders for that site immediately. Outstanding invoices route to the Kestrel Park office. Lease termination costs are accrued; payroll transfers are handled by HR. Asset disposal list due Friday. Do not discuss externally until the announcement. The confidential planning detail you need is stated directly below.

management briefing: Project Ulavan slips by two quarters because of the staffing delay.

**Vendor note: Inkmill markdown pipeline**

Rendering for Parchway docs is outsourced to Inkmill under an annual contract, renewing each March. They handle sanitization and PDF export; we own the upload queue. SLA: 4-hour response on rendering failures. Escalate only after two failed retries. Their support desk is reachable at the address below.

billing contact of hahaf-baguf = zorael.tammir.jorius@sivrelhq.internal

Subject: Handover — Quotaline release duties

Hi Maren,

Taking over from me this cycle: Quotaline enforces per-tenant rate quotas, and each release updates the quota schema consumed by the gateways. Cut the release Tuesday, run the schema diff check, and confirm the Thornbury tenants migrate cleanly before general rollout. Gateways reject unsigned schema bundles outright, so sign each one before publishing. The signing key to use is below.

rollout seal: bky4_x7Gc